    Xbox 360 woes

    Ok, so I had talked to Microsoft and they were not willing to cover my box under warranty (it was manufactured in 05, and has worked perfectly since day 1). So, after scouring the internet for an hour or 2, I decided to try to fix it myself. I was planning on taking it apart later today, but I decided to try something before I did. It's called the "towel trick" and it's supposed to work for both RROD and the no video issue that I was having. Anywho, you wrap the xbox in 2 towels, and turn it on. Let it run for 20minutes (it will probably shut itself off due to the heat). Afterwards, wait 20-30min for it to cool. Then power back on. Worked like a charm for me! Apparently, it heats the solder on the GPU up enough to "correct itself". Surely it's only a temporary fix, but it saves me from having to open it up today! Time for some COD4...
